Griffon Corporation Awarded $3.7 Million Contract From United States Coast Guard

Oct. 8, 2007

JERICHO, N.Y., Oct. 8 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Griffon Corporation (NYSE: GFF) announced today that Telephonics Corporation, its electronic information and communication systems subsidiary, has been awarded a $3.7M contract from the United States Coast Guard for Submersible TruLink(R) Wireless Intercommunication Systems. The Submersible TruLink is a modified version of its current wireless intercommunications system presently used by commercial and military customers. TruLink provides hands-free, untethered voice communications in very high noise environments. The Submersible TruLink has been designed to survive the harsh maritime environment and will operate after submergence depths of up to 20 feet.

This is a follow-on order to initial systems that were designed, developed and successfully tested for United States Coast Guard maritime applications. "The systems will be installed on USCG 47' Motor Lifeboats and Defender Class vessels to support Ports Waterway, Coastal, Security (PWCS) Missions. We are pleased to have the opportunity to support USCG with wireless intercommunications that will improve crew safety and enhance their ability to conduct these important Home Land Security missions," stated Phil Nicholas , President of the Telephonics Communication Systems Division.

The Submersible TruLink System is supplied under a five-year Indefinite Delivery/ Indefinite Quantity (IDIQ) contract with the U.S. Coast Guard. Work on this program will be performed at the Telephonics facilities in Farmingdale and Huntington, N.Y.

About Telephonics

"A subsidiary of Griffon Corporation (NYSE: GFF), Telephonics' broad- based, advanced, high-technology engineering and manufacturing capabilities provide integrated information, communication, and sensor system solutions to military and commercial markets worldwide. The company is organized into four operating divisions: Communications Systems, specializing in aircraft intercommunication systems, ruggedized wireless communication systems, and commercial audio products; Radar Systems, specializing in airborne maritime surveillance radar, weather and search radar, and advanced identification friend or foe products; Electronic Systems specializing in aerospace electronics, air traffic management systems and Homeland Security products; and the Systems Engineering Group specializing in the performance of threat and radar system analyses and other support engineering functions for the Department of Defense, the Missile Defense Agency, and various other Government agencies and major prime contractors."

About Griffon Corporation

In addition to developing and manufacturing information and communication systems for government and commercial markets worldwide, Griffon Corporation is also an international leader in the development and production of embossed and laminated specialty plastic films used in the baby diaper, feminine napkin, adult incontinent, surgical and patient care markets. Griffon Corporation is also a leading manufacturer and marketer of residential, commercial and industrial garage doors sold to professional installing dealers and major home center retail chains. Through a substantial network of operations located throughout the country, Griffon's building products company also installs and services specialty building products, primarily garage doors, openers, fireplaces and cabinets for new construction markets.
